Irish bank governor warns €9.4 billion budget plan could overheat economy amid trade concerns.
Irish Central Bank Governor Gabriel Makhlouf warned against over-stimulating the economy in the upcoming October budget.
The government plans a €9.4 billion tax and spending package, but Makhlouf suggests this could lead to an overheated economy, especially given full employment and potential U.S. tariffs.
Prominent economist Dan O'Brien also calls for prudence, advising to postpone tax cuts and spending increases until the impact of the EU-US trade deal is clearer.
